Key

  • Pupils: the number of pupils attending the school
  • English, Maths and Science: the percentage of pupils achieving at least level four in each subject, the standard expected by the Government
  • Agg.: the average aggregate score achieved by pupils at the school in the previous three years, where the aggregate is the combined total of the English, Maths and Science figures
  • VA: value-added score, based on the progress individual pupils have made between tests when they are in Year 2 (Key Stage 1), generally aged 7, and tests taken when they are in Year 6 (Key Stage 2) and generally aged 11
  • < or NA: no information is available

Data supplied by Department for Education and Skills 2007
